Join our growing HR Talent Acquisition team! In line with Villanova’s strategic plan, Rooted. Restless. and under the guidance of the Director of Talent Acquisition, the Talent Acquisition Specialist will execute the University-wide talent acquisition process and will play a critical role in ensuring success in the attraction and employment of top talent. This role will be responsible for managing the Affirmative Action Plan, ensuring compliance with relevant regulations and enhancing our recruitment strategies. The role consults with hiring managers on all aspects of talent acquisition from job postings and recruitment strategy, sourcing and screening candidates, and presenting/negotiating offers. The Talent Acquisition and Diversity Specialist develops an understanding of the University’s talent needs and utilizes strategies to execute consistent and effective recruitment processes in compliance with all applicable policies, rules, regulations, and labor laws. A successful Talent Acquisition and Diversity Specialist will be dedicated to building relationships and processes while creating an equitable and engaging hiring process for all involved!

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Coordinate position review and posting process. Develop timelines and milestones for the search process and approve/route requisitions in the applicant tracking system.
  • Ensure all job descriptions and postings are accurate and compliant with all federal/state laws and University policy.
  • Become a trusted talent partner, build relationships and develop an understanding of the community’s talent needs. Consult with hiring managers on recruitment procedures and processes, and the development of recruitment strategies to decrease the time to fill/hire.
  • Manage and drive a structured interview process. Prescreen applications, select and refer qualified candidates, and conduct initial interviews as needed.
  • Assist hiring managers and search committees in the development of role-specific and behavioral interview questions and selection rubrics. Monitor candidate pools to ensure searches are progressing, hiring managers are timely in their recruitment activities, and hiring recommendations are defensible and support the chosen candidates.
  • Deliver a smooth and exceptional candidate experience from the first outreach. Evaluate the University’s current processes, tools, and resources and make recommendations to increase effectiveness and improve the candidate experience.
  • Recommend starting salaries, in partnership with the Compensation team, conduct thorough reference checks, and deliver and negotiate offers. Coordinate timely hiring processing in partnership with the Senior Talent Acquisition Coordinator.
  • Research ways to attract new candidates and develop innovative sourcing strategies to enhance diverse candidate pools for current and future openings.
  • Drive equity and inclusion at every stage of the talent acquisition process.
  • Develop, implement, and manage the Affirmative Action Plan (AAP) in compliance with federal and state regulations.
  • Conduct regular audits and assessments to ensure adherence to AAP requirements and address any discrepancies.
  • Prepare and submit required reports and documentation related to the AAP.
  • Monitor and report on diversity metrics and outcomes, ensuring alignment with organizational goals.
  • Performs additional duties and assists with special projects as assigned.
